One great option is City Guesser, which immerses players in short video clips of cities around the world. Instead of still images, you get a real-time view of the bustling life in various urban settings. Your task is to identify the city by observing details such as architecture, street signs, and local culture. This dynamic gameplay not only tests your geographical knowledge but also allows you to experience the vibrancy of different cities as if you were wandering through them.

Another exciting alternative is Seterra, an interactive quiz platform designed to help players learn geography through fun challenges. With a variety of quizzes covering countries, capitals, flags, and geographical features, Seterra caters to all skill levels. You can choose different difficulty settings, making it suitable for both beginners and more experienced players. As you progress through the quizzes, you’ll expand your knowledge and gain a better understanding of global geography in a stimulating environment.

If you’re looking for a comprehensive exploration tool, Google Earth is a must-try. While not strictly a game, Google Earth allows users to navigate the globe in stunning detail, offering breathtaking views of landscapes, cities, and landmarks. The Voyager feature provides curated tours that delve into various themes, enhancing your understanding of different cultures and histories. You can explore everything from the Great Barrier Reef to the bustling streets of New York, making it a powerful resource for virtual travel and education.
